The lymphatic system is a network of vessels, lymph nodes, and organs that helps maintain fluid balance, supports immune function, and transports cellular waste throughout the body. Often referred to as the body's natural drainage system, it plays an essential role in protecting your health and promoting normal healing.
The lymphatic system helps filter excess fluid, cellular waste, bacteria, toxins, and other foreign substances while transporting lymph fluid back into the bloodstream. This process supports a healthy immune system and helps maintain proper fluid balance throughout the body.
When lymph flow becomes sluggish or impaired due to surgery, illness, injury, inflammation, or other factors, fluid, proteins, and cellular waste can accumulate, contributing to swelling, inflammation, discomfort, delayed recovery, bloating and fatigue.
Manual Lymphatic Drainage (MLD) is a gentle, specialized hands-on therapy that uses precise, rhythmic movements and light pressure to encourage the natural movement of lymphatic fluid. Since the lymphatic vessels are located just beneath the skin, only a very light touch is needed.
